We use the published Planck and SPT cluster catalogs [1, 2] and recently published y-distortion maps [3] to put strong observational limits on the contribution of the fluctuating part of the y-type distortions to the y-distortion monopole. Our bounds are 5.4 x 10(-8) < < y > < 2.2 x 10(-6). Our upper bound is a factor of 6.8 stronger than the currently best upper 95% confidence limit from COBE-FIRAS of < y > < 15 x 10(-6). In the standard cosmology, large scale structure is the only source of such distortions and our limits therefore constrain the baryonic physics involved in the formation of the large scale structure. Our lower limit, from the detected clusters in the Planck and SPT catalogs, also implies that a Pixie-like experiment should detect the y-distortion monopole at > 27-sigma. The biggest sources of uncertainty in our upper limit are the monopole offsets between different HFI channel maps that we estimate to be < 10(-6).
